Estimated Price Range
Estimated cost range for residential siding installation in Howard County, MD: $1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
Typical project costs vary based on siding material, home size, and complexity: $1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Vinyl Siding | $1,200 - $3,000 |
| Fiber Cement Siding | $2,500 - $7,000 |
| Wood Siding | $3,000 - $8,000 |
| Engineered Wood Siding | $2,500 - $6,500 |
| Aluminum Siding | $2,000 - $5,000 |
| Stucco Siding | $6,000 - $10,000 |

Project Size and Scope
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Single-family home (small) | $5,000 - $12,000 |
| Single-family home (large) | $12,000 - $30,000 |
| Apartment building (per unit) | $4,000 - $8,000 |
| Major siding replacement (entire building) | $50,000 - $150,000 |
